A Poem by J.L. Davenport


When I look at you, I wish so many things

So many things I know will never be

I am aware you do not really see

That when I kiss you I dream

I dream like a schoolgirl with her first crush

Within my black skin I blush

It doesn't feel right that I should feel this way

About a man, I do not see everyday or every month

Oh, the years will soon become few and it still feels new

When you enter into my receiving, body so close to my womb�

It is you and your deliverance

When you are pleased and you smile at me

I want more

Can you see thoroughly my needs?

You have barely touched my fervid flesh

Nor kissed and hugged me as much

Has the scent of my soft moist skin even set in?

So that in the morning you can sniff at the beauty, you began

And ended with you

The idyll light that sparkles in my eyes

I am saddened

I am not satisfied

It is tears lapping against my eyeballs

Blatant stare because I will not blink

I do not want you to see me cry

I do not want you to think

I just want you to know it doesn't feel right leeching to the dream

The more I dream the stranger you become
